Package org.openzen.zenscript.formatter
Class FormattingUtils
java.lang.Object
org.openzen.zenscript.formatter.FormattingUtils
-
Method Summary
Modifier and TypeMethodDescriptionstatic voidformatBody(StringBuilder output, ScriptFormattingSettings settings, String indent, TypeFormatter typeFormatter, Statement body) static voidformatCall(StringBuilder result, TypeFormatter typeFormatter, ExpressionFormatter expressionFormatter, CallArguments arguments) static voidformatHeader(StringBuilder result, ScriptFormattingSettings settings, FunctionHeader header, TypeFormatter typeFormatter) static voidformatModifiers(StringBuilder output, int modifiers) static voidformatTypeParameters(StringBuilder result, TypeParameter[] parameters, TypeFormatter typeFormatter)
-
Method Details
-
formatModifiers
-
formatHeader
public static void formatHeader(StringBuilder result, ScriptFormattingSettings settings, FunctionHeader header, TypeFormatter typeFormatter) -
formatTypeParameters
public static void formatTypeParameters(StringBuilder result, TypeParameter[] parameters, TypeFormatter typeFormatter) -
formatBody
public static void formatBody(StringBuilder output, ScriptFormattingSettings settings, String indent, TypeFormatter typeFormatter, Statement body) -
formatCall
public static void formatCall(StringBuilder result, TypeFormatter typeFormatter, ExpressionFormatter expressionFormatter, CallArguments arguments)
-